Tubing lengths in excess of sixty (60) feet see application software.
1 Certified in accordance with the Air-Source Unitary Air-conditioner Equipment
certification program, which is based on AHRI standard 210/240.
2 Rated in accordance with AHRI standard 270.
3 Calculated in accordance with Natl. Elec. Codes. Use only HACR circuit breakers or
fuses.
4 Standard Air — Dry Coil — Outdoor
5 This value approximate. For more precise value see unit nameplate.
6 Max. linear length 60 ft.; Max. lift - Suction 60 ft.; Max lift - Liquid 60 ft.
For greater length consult refrigerant piping software Pub. No. 32-3312-0*
(* denotes latest revision).
7 This value shown for compressor RLA on the unit nameplate and on this specification
sheet is used to compute minimum branch circuit ampacity and max. fuse size. The
value shown is the branch circuit selection current.
8 No means no start components. Yes means quick start kit components. PTC means
positive temperature coefficient starter.

COMPRESSOR MOTOR ROTATION
DISCONNECT ALL POWER TO COMPRESSOR WHEN
COMPRESSOR MOTOR ROTATION IS REVERSED. CHANGE
ANY TWO CUSTOMER POWER LEADS TO CORRECT ROTATION.
Failure to change customer power leads to correct compressor
rotation may result in compressor damage during operation.
